I've got the matte finish titanium lower half (two tone paint job), and while washing it at a Ford dealership I put some degreaser on the front end to get some of the bugs off (I used to work there, did this with every vehicle and never had a problem). Apparently the matte finish is different though, because it put dark streaks all over the titanium colored parts! Soap didn't work, teflon wax didn't work, nothing so far has been successful. Does anyone have any more suggestions on things to try? It looks horrible, and repainting all of the titanium pieces (gotta match color) will cost several hundred dollars...Gah!

Is the matte finish original? If not, check with the paint maker. If it is, look in your owner's handbook for care.

Probably a pre-wax cleaner is in order to freshen the finish. Try in an inconspicuous area and see how it looks.
